Upper Fort
SUPPORTEDThe hill’s upper defensive area belongs to the wider fort landscape. Comparing the historic survey with a measured site survey is necessary to identify individual remains.

- View of the north face of the fort, Gurramkonda
Thomas Fraser · British Library · c. 1802 · WD506.
PRIMARY / ARCHIVAL
How this source is used: Watercolour with a key. The catalogue identifies the lower fort and works covering the ascent. The original digital viewer was unavailable during research.
